How to disable page notifications on LinkedIn

Here is how to disable page notifications on linkedin

  1. First click on the "Me" dropdown menu in the top navigation bar
  2. Then click on "Settings & Privacy" option from the dropdown menu
  3. Next click on "Notifications" section in the left sidebar
  4. Then click on "Pages" option in the notification settings list
  5. Finally toggle the "Allow Page notifications" switch to turn it off

Why should you disable page notifications on LinkedIn

LinkedIn is a professional networking platform designed to connect industry professionals and foster career growth.

Disabling page notifications on LinkedIn allows users to streamline their activity feed, focusing on what truly matters. This feature contributes to a less cluttered notification center, offering a more personalized and effective user experience.

By managing your notifications, it helps minimize distractions, enabling you to dedicate your attention to engaging with meaningful content that aligns with your professional goals.
